Canceled: Woke (Hulu)
The Lamorne Morris-starring Woke, inspired by the life of award-winning artist Keith Knight, was canceled after two seasons on Hulu.
Renewed: Selling Sunset (Netflix)
On June 22, Netflix announced that the glitzy real estate saga been renewed for not one, but two more seasons. Production on season six is expected to start in summer 2022.
Ending: Workin' Moms (CBC Television)
The Canadian sitcom, which streams on Netflix in the United States, will be ending with its seventh season.
Renewed: Hacks (HBO Max)
Deborah and Ava's story continues in season three of the HBO Max series, written by Lucia Aniello, Paul W. Downs and Jen Statsky.
Canceled: Made For Love (HBO Max)
HBO Max announced season two of Made For Love will be the show's last. "We are tremendously grateful for the truly spectacular journey of these past two seasons, courtesy of Alissa Nutting, Christina Lee, Cristin, Billy, Ray and the entire Made For Love cast and creative team—especially Zelda the talking dolphin and everyone's favorite synthetic love interest, Diane," an HBO Max representative said in a statement. "Like a Gogol chip, the series will always be on our minds."
Renewed: Schmigadoon (Apple TV+)
Apple TV+ renewed the series for season two and added two new stars to the cast: Titus Burgess and Patrick Page.
Renewed: The Summer I Turned Pretty (Prime Video)
Ahead of the season one premiere, Prime Video has renewed The Summer I Turned Pretty for a second season.
Renewed: Tokyo Vice (HBO Max)
The Ansel Elgort-led series has been renewed by HBO Max.
Renewed: What We Do in the Shadows (FX)
What We Do in the Shadows will be back for a fifth and sixth season on FX.
Canceled: Legends of the Hidden Temple (The CW)
Legends of the Hidden Temple reboot is canceled after one season on The CW.
Renewed: Is It Cake? (Netflix)
We hope your sweet tooth is ready!
Netflix's Is It Cake? has officially been renewed for a second season.
Renewed: Black Lady Sketch Show (HBO)
HBO's Black Lady Sketch Show will return with Robin Thede, Gabrielle Dennis, Ashley Nicole Black and Skye Townsend for a fourth season.
Renewed: Slow Horses (Apple TV+)
The Gary Oldman-fronted series has been renewed for two seasons after premiering this April.
Ending: The Good Fight (Paramount+)
Season six will be The Good Fight's last. The showrunners announced their decision on May 27, telling Variety they don't want to "overstay your welcome."
